Operated by Rio Tinto from 1971-89. During that time it was one of the largest Open Pit Mines in the world. Mostly Copper with some Gold & Silver. Large alluvial fan of mine tailings to the southwest.
Numerous pieces of abandoned equipment visible. At least 40 haul trucks and a couple of draglines.
The main buildings look like the metal roof & wall materials has been removed.
Closed by local protests & power cut.
